On startup, the app now checks if the database schema version matches
the code. If there's a mismatch or no version exists, it automatically
runs a full data migration before starting.

- Add backend/version.py with SCHEMA_VERSION constant
- Add backend/migration.py with extracted migration logic
- Add SchemaVersion model to track DB version
- Add version check functions to database.py
- Update app.py lifespan to use check_and_migrate_if_needed()
- Simplify migrate_csv_to_db.py to use shared logic

def get_db_schema_version() -> Optional[int]:
"""
Get the current schema version from the database.
Returns None if table doesn't exist or no version is set.
"""
from .models import SchemaVersion # Import here to avoid circular imports
# Check if schema_version table exists
inspector = inspect(engine)
if "schema_version" not in inspector.get_table_names():
return None
try:
with get_db_session() as db:
row = db.query(SchemaVersion).first()
return row.version if row else None
except Exception:
return None
def set_db_schema_version(version: int):
"""
Set/update the schema version in the database.
Creates the row if it doesn't exist.
"""
from .models import SchemaVersion
with get_db_session() as db:
row = db.query(SchemaVersion).first()
if row:
row.version = version
row.migrated_at = datetime.utcnow()
else:
db.add(SchemaVersion(id=1, version=version, migrated_at=datetime.utcnow()))
def check_and_migrate_if_needed():
"""
Check schema version and run migration if needed.
Called during application startup.
"""
from .version import SCHEMA_VERSION
from .migration import run_full_migration
db_version = get_db_schema_version()
if db_version == SCHEMA_VERSION:
print(f"Schema version {SCHEMA_VERSION} matches. Fast startup.")
# Still ensure tables exist (they should if version matches)
init_db()
return
if db_version is None:
print(f"No schema version found. Running initial migration (v{SCHEMA_VERSION})...")
else:
print(f"Schema mismatch: DB has v{db_version}, code expects v{SCHEMA_VERSION}")
print("Running full migration...")
try:
success = run_full_migration(geocode=False)
if success:
# Ensure schema_version table exists before writing
init_db()
set_db_schema_version(SCHEMA_VERSION)
print(f"Migration complete. Schema version set to {SCHEMA_VERSION}")
else:
print("Warning: Migration completed but no data was imported.")
init_db()
set_db_schema_version(SCHEMA_VERSION)
except Exception as e:
print(f"FATAL: Migration failed: {e}")
print("Application cannot start. Please check database and CSV files.")
raise
